    Quality & Safety Manager

    Job Summary

    • The Quality and Safety Manager is responsible for overseeing and managing all aspects of quality assurance and safety programs within the airline.
    • This role ensures compliance with industry standards, regulatory requirements, and internal policies.
    • The manager will develop, implement, and monitor safety management systems (SMS), quality control processes, and continuous improvement initiatives to enhance operational efficiency and safety.
    • The QSM is responsible for the day-to-day management of safety and security risks in United Nigeria Airlines operations.

    Duties/Responsiblities:

    Safety Management:

    • Develop, implement, and maintain the airline’s Safety Management System (SMS) in accordance with regulatory requirements.
    • Conduct safety risk assessments and hazard analyses, and ensure that mitigation strategies are effectively implemented.
    • Oversee incident and accident investigations, ensuring that root causes are identified, and corrective actions are taken.
    • Promote a safety culture throughout the organization by conducting training, workshops, and awareness programs.
    • Liaise with aviation authorities and other regulatory bodies regarding safety issues and compliance.

    Quality Assurance:

    • Develop and implement the Quality Management System (QMS) to ensure compliance with industry standards (e.g., IOSA, ISO, NCAA)
    • Conduct regular audits and inspections of operational procedures, maintenance practices, and other critical functions to ensure adherence to quality standards.
    • Monitor and evaluate the effectiveness of the QMS and identify areas for continuous improvement.
    • Establish a quality system in the company that complies with all relevant aviation regulations and directives as approved by NCAA and set forth in Nig CARs that corresponds to the needs and requirements of United Nigeria Airlines.

    Regulatory Compliance:

    • Ensure compliance with all relevant aviation regulations, including those set by the International Civil Aviation Organization (ICAO), the Nigeria Civil Aviation Authority (NCAA) and other applicable bodies.
    • Keep up-to-date with changes in aviation regulations and standards, and ensure the airline’s operations remain compliant and monitor all internal exemptions related to maintenance program and Mel
    • Prepare and submit reports to regulatory bodies as required and monitor the expiry date of the AOC and ensures it is renewed on time.

    Incident Management:

    • Lead the investigation of safety incidents and quality non-conformances
    • Collaborate with relevant departments to develop and implement corrective and preventive actions
    • Maintain incident reporting systems and ensure accurate documentation of all safety and quality incidents.

    Training and Development

    • Develop and deliver training programs related to safety, quality, and compliance for staff at all levels.
    • Provide guidance and support to staff on safety and quality matters
    • Ensure that all personnel are aware of their responsibilities regarding safety and quality
    • Lead initiatives to improve safety performance, operational efficiency, and quality standards.
    •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) related to safety and quality and report on trends and areas for improvement.
    • Writes and manages the quality manual, supervises the job of the document controller personnel and the performance of the quality inspectors and auditors.
    • Coordinates with management on the evaluation of the nominated post holders  
    • Foster a culture of continuous improvement across the organization
